Lip fillers have become increasingly popular for enhancing the appearance of the lips, offering a range of options from subtle enhancements to more dramatic transformations. When it comes to achieving a subtle look, the key lies in the expertise of the practitioner and the choice of filler.
Subtle lip augmentation involves carefully selecting the right type of filler that provides a natural-looking result. Hyaluronic acid-based fillers, such as Restylane and Juvederm, are often preferred for their ability to integrate seamlessly with the body's tissues, resulting in a soft and natural feel. These fillers can be injected in precise amounts to enhance the lip's volume without creating an overly plump or artificial appearance.
The technique used by the practitioner is also crucial. A skilled injector will focus on enhancing the natural contours of the lips, such as the cupid's bow and the philtrum, to create a balanced and harmonious look. They will also consider the patient's facial structure and proportions to ensure the enhancement is in line with the overall aesthetic.
Additionally, the use of micro-injections can help achieve a more subtle effect. These small, targeted injections can add just the right amount of volume to the lips, making them appear fuller and more defined without drawing too much attention.
In summary, lip fillers can indeed be subtle when administered by a skilled professional using the right type of filler and technique. The goal is to enhance the natural beauty of the lips, providing a soft, natural-looking result that complements the individual's facial features.

Achieving a Subtle Lip Enhancement with Hyaluronic Acid Fillers
When it comes to lip augmentation, many patients seek a natural, subtle enhancement rather than an overly dramatic change. Hyaluronic acid fillers, such as those in the Restylane or Juvederm family, are excellent choices for achieving this delicate balance. As a medical professional, I often emphasize the importance of a conservative approach to ensure the results look natural and harmonious with the patient's facial features.
Understanding the Patient's Desires
The first step in any cosmetic procedure is a thorough consultation. During this time, I take the opportunity to understand the patient's aesthetic goals and expectations. For those desiring a subtle lip enhancement, I guide them through the process of selecting the right filler and the appropriate amount to achieve a natural look. It's crucial to manage expectations and explain that a subtle enhancement will still provide noticeable, yet natural-looking results.
Choosing the Right Filler
Hyaluronic acid fillers come in various formulations, each with its own unique properties. For a subtle lip enhancement, I typically recommend fillers with smaller particle sizes, such as Restylane Silk or Juvederm Ultra. These products are designed to provide a softer, more natural look and feel, which is ideal for patients seeking a minimal yet effective enhancement.
Precision in Application
The technique used to inject the filler is just as important as the type of filler chosen. I use a meticulous, layered approach to ensure even distribution and avoid any lumps or over-inflated areas. By carefully placing the filler in strategic areas, such as the vermillion border and the body of the lip, I can enhance the lip's natural shape and volume without making it look overly augmented.
Post-Procedure Care
After the procedure, I provide detailed aftercare instructions to ensure the best possible outcome. This includes avoiding strenuous activities, applying ice to reduce swelling, and gently massaging the lips if necessary. By following these guidelines, patients can minimize any temporary side effects and enjoy their natural-looking results sooner.
Conclusion
In conclusion, achieving a subtle lip enhancement with hyaluronic acid fillers is entirely possible with the right approach. By understanding the patient's desires, choosing the appropriate filler, and applying it with precision, I can help patients achieve a natural, beautiful result that enhances their overall appearance without looking overdone.
